Let's say you're working and earn N150,000 monthly. As a quick and simple rule of thumb, how much money is recommended you allocate for your savings, needs, and wants respectively?

a. 0k, 50k, 100k
b. 40k, 90k, 10k
c. 75k, 75k, 0k
d. 30k, 75k, 45k
e. I don't know

I recommend option b: 40k for savings, 90k for needs, and 10k for wants.

This allocation strikes a balance between saving for the future, covering essential expenses, and allowing for some discretionary spending. Prioritizing savings at 40k ensures you're building a financial safety net over time. Allocating 90k for needs covers your essential living expenses, providing a stable foundation. The remaining 10k for wants allows for some personal enjoyment without jeopardizing your financial stability.

This choice is based on the principle of financial prudence, ensuring you're saving for the future while still enjoying the present. It's a practical approach that reflects a commitment to both fiscal responsibility and personal well-being.
